After flying high against Portage Central on Saturday, Gaylord came back down to earth. The Blue Devils fell just short of the Gladstone Braves by a score of 4-3 on Saturday. The Blue Devils were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Braves ap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in May of 2023.
Gaylord saw two different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Lilly Lauer, who went 1-for-2 with one stolen base, one run, and one double.

Gaylord moved to 17-3 with that defeat, which also ended their six-game winning streak. As for Gladstone, the victory made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 20-1.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Gaylord will face off against Petoskey at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The Northmen's pitching crew has only allowed 3.7 runs per game this season, so the Blue Devils' h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Gladstone, they will challenge Escanaba at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
